General description
2,2′-[4-(2-Hydroxyethylamino)-3-nitrophenylimino]diethanol (HC Blue No.2) is a water-soluble purple dye.
Application
2,2′-[4-(2-Hydroxyethylamino)-3-nitrophenylimino]diethanol may be employed to improve the visibility of self-healing ureidopyrimidinone (UPy) hydrogel (poly(ethylene glycol) containing bifunctional UDP groups).
